Statistics and Data Analysis Training with SPSS

MODULE 1: Creating and Organizing Data with SPSS

  • Coding and entering data from a questionnaire into SPSS
  • Adjusting variable properties in SPSS
  • Handling missing values using SPSS
  • Computing new variables in SPSS

MODULE 2: Descriptive Analyses with SPSS

  • Frequency tables and descriptive statistics in SPSS
  • Cross-tabulation tables in SPSS
  • Creating charts and graphs with SPSS

MODULE 3: Bivariate Tests with SPSS

  • Correlation tests: Pearson, Spearman, partial, and canonical correlations in SPSS
  • Chi-square (χ²) test with SPSS

MODULE 4: Parametric and Non-Parametric Tests with SPSS

  • T-test with SPSS
  • Analysis of Variance (One-way ANOVA) with SPSS
  • Z-test with SPSS
  • Kolmogorov-Smirnov (K-S) test with SPSS
  • Wilcoxon test with SPSS
  • McNemar test with SPSS
  • Mann-Whitney U test with SPSS

Master Git: Manage Your Versions and Collaborate Effectively

Module 1: Introduction to Git

Objective: Understand the usefulness of Git in version control and project development.

  • Introduction to version control in the context of a static website project.
  • Install and configure Git as well as Python, Pip, GitHub, GitLab, and MkDocs.
  • Overview of Git and its ecosystem (GitHub, GitLab, Bitbucket, etc.).

Module 2: Working Alone with Git

Objective: Master the fundamentals of Git for an individual static website project using Python and Markdown.

  • Basic commands: git init, git config.
  • Track and record changes: git add, git status, git commit.
  • Explore previous versions: git log, git diff.
  • Manage versions: git tag.
  • Publish online: git push.
  • Discover MkDocs, some Python, and Markdown to run the site locally and host it online.
  • Discover other concepts: branches (git branch, git checkout), a YAML file, a README.md, on GitHub and GitLab.
  • Clone an online project: git clone.
  • Work with command aliases.

Module 3: Working in a Team with Git

Objective: Learn how to use Git in a collaborative environment.

  • Discover team types: owner and collaborator for a 2-person project, or equal collaborators.
  • Manage teams and define permissions.
  • Review commands and add updates to synchronize the local repository with the central repository: git fetch, git pull.
  • Best practices for teamwork with Git.

Module 4: Pull Request (Merge Request)

Objective: Master the process of requesting code integration through a Pull Request.

  • Introduction to Pull Requests, contributing to a project, and the code review / merge request process.
  • Create and submit a Pull Request.
  • Handle a conflict-free request: approve or reject the request.
  • Update your repository: git fetch, git pull.
  • Strategies for managing Pull Requests within a team.

Module 5: Managing Merge Conflicts

Objective: Learn how to handle and resolve version conflicts.

  • Understand merge conflicts: causes and how to detect them.
  • Handle a request with conflicts: proceed or reject the request.
  • Resolve conflicts manually: git status, git mergetool.
  • Use conflict resolution tools (VS Code, Meld, etc.).
  • Best practices to avoid conflicts: use the stash git stash.
  • Manage the stash: add, apply, drop, and more.

Module 6: Synchronization and Continuous Integration

Objective: Manage team integration workflows.

  • Differentiate between origin and upstream repositories.
  • Introduction to CI/CD concepts, continuous integration, and triangular workflows.
  • Introduction to branches: git branch, git checkout -b.
  • Introduction to HTTP and SSH remotes and managing SSH encryption keys.
  • Discover backtracking, history, and other user-friendly tools.
  • Explore the CI/CD pipeline, continuous integration, and continuous deployment.
